Pekin wins meet at Albia
Girls cross-country Panthers take places 3, 5, 8, 11, 12
Doug Brenneman
Aug. 31, 2021 6:27 am
ALBIA — Pekin High School won the girls cross-country meet at Albia Golf and Leisure Club Monday. The Pekin boys, Van Buren County boys and girls did not have enough runners for a team score.
Rylee Dunkin of Twin Cedars won the girls meet in 20 minutes, 14 seconds. RC Hicks of Wayne won the boys title in 17:41.
Pekin had third place in both races with Zack Wise running a 18:02 and Lauren Dersheid finishing in 21:19. Teammate Lauren Steigleder was close behind in fifth place at 21:40. The Panthers also had eighth, 11th and 12th place finishers.
